I found out my elderly Mum was paying £128 every 6 months, despite the web site offering the same at £65 (auto-renew) or £55 (one-off). On cancelling I was offered a renewal deal of £27.50 every 6 months on auto-renew and decided to accept. However, they registered this as £55 and when queried said that the offer was not available to existing subscribers and I'd be charged the full £128 at renewal and would have to scrap it out with the Retention Team.
I cancelled properly at that point.

I have subscribed to Radio Times - Print + Digital for several years. In the past, where print issues have failed to arrive on time, I have used the "Radio Times Magazine" app on Android obtained from the Google PlayStore. Inputting my subscription number gave me access to a digital facsimile of the pages of the print edition. Several issues have been very late recently but, on this occasion, entering my subscription number did not give me access.
I contacted Support, and began an email exchange with Angel Mortarino. Angel took 17 days to reply to my last email, and insisted that:
"While your confirmation states “Radio Times – Print + Digital”, the digital access included refers specifically to the What to Watch app only, and not to the digital edition of the magazine."
I replied:
"Angel
I understood that "Digital Edition" meant the app that presented the same pages as the print edition, and I believe that is what any reasonable person would take it to mean. I have seen nothing in any terms and conditions to say that it means another app that bears very little resemblance to the print edition of Radio Times. If that is the case I would contend that the "digital" element of my subscription was sold under false pretences.
I have cancelled my subscription."
The "Radio Times Magazine" app is a digital copy of the print edition, and I understood that this is what I was paying for. According to the response from support, it only covers the separate "Radio Times - What to Watch" app, which is no use to me. This is very sharp practice, and I consider it to be selling under false pretences.
